If you cull animals or plants, you kill or remove them: to cull growing herds before they run out of food culling dead timber WebA cull cow is a beef cow that is no longer productive typically due to age or health problems. These cows are typically sent to slaughter to be used for meat. Culling beef cows is a common practice in the cattle industry. It allows farmers and ranchers to improve the quality of their herds by getting rid of cows that are no longer productive. merrem anaerobic coverage

WebOct 26, 2024 · What is cull cow? A “cull cow” is a beef cow that has been removed from a herd due to poor performance or physical problems. Culling cattle refers to the process of removing animals from a herd that are not performing up to the standards required by the farmer.
